The Mossos are searching for the rapist of a woman who had gone out for a run in Vidreres

The Mossos d’Esquadra are searching for the young man who last Saturday the 12th at noon assaulted a girl of about 22 years old who was running through a forested area of the Aiguaviva Parc urbanization in Vidreres (Girona) and raped her. According to sources close to the case, the attacker was carrying a sickle in his hand at the moment he encountered the victim, and they did not know each other.

The Mossos have confirmed that the rape occurred on Saturday at noon, but have not provided further information about this case, which would be the first of this nature to happen in Vidreres in the last 15 years, according to municipal sources.

The events took place in a forested area of the Aiguaviva Parc Urbanization, a large residential development where single-family homes predominate and where, according to the National Institute of Statistics (INE), in 2024 there were 1,891 inhabitants out of a total of 8,995.

Once they became aware of the events, through 112, several Mossos d’Esquadra patrols went to where the victim, of Spanish nationality, was, who was taken to a reference hospital for this type of case to be examined by a forensic doctor, as the protocol dictates. She was also offered psychological and legal assistance.

For its part, the investigation of the case passed into the hands of the agents of the Criminal Investigation Division (DIC) of Girona. One of the hypotheses considered as to why the attacker would carry a sickle is that he was collecting shrubs such as heather or mastic. This activity has been common for a few weeks in the forests of Girona, and it is easy to find people in vans doing this type of collection for commercial or industrial purposes.
